We also offer a selection of front door options including flush and lipped French doors. Sash windows London's capital is renowned for its traditional windows made of sash. They can be found in a variety of homes including grand stately homes to Victorian terraces which have been transformed into luxurious apartments. Historically, these were made out of timber and contained tiny panes of glass that were separated by glazing bars. Window sashes (the term used to describe the part that slides in the window) were held in place by cast iron or wooden counterweights and pulleys that were powered by cords, and used to open and close. Sash windows are infamous for being difficult to open and close, and for letting in drafts. The mechanisms can become stuck or their sashes be misaligned, resulting in costly repairs. The good part is that sash windows can be uprated to offer you all the advantages of modern double-glazing without having to replace them all. A specialist firm can install a high-quality insulation unit inside the sash window you already have to improve energy efficiency. This will lower the cost of heating and also increase the curb appeal of your home. It will also add value. UPVC sash windows are becoming more popular with homeowners. They can be made to look just like their timber counterparts. In addition to being an affordable alternative windows, they are also easier to maintain and are more resistant to weathering. In contrast to older timber sash windows uPVC windows don't require staining or painting to keep them looking their best. The primary benefit of the sash window is that it can be opened from the top or bottom, which gives you a lot of airflow and light. They can be slid to the side of the house for effortless cleaning. Casement windows As the name suggests, the casement windows are hinged on both sides of the frame and open outwards like a door. These windows are also one of the most energy efficient windows on the market. They let in plenty of light, let in air and do not have to worry about drafts. If you're in the market for a uPVC or a timber casement window There are a variety of designs and sizes to choose from. There are a variety of types of casement windows, so it is important to know what you want before you shop around. The most common type is a standard casement window that opens with a small mechanical crank or a push-out handle. The handle also serves as a latch that keeps the window closed and secure when it is not being used. Casement windows are sought-after in modern homes because they're more adaptable than sash windows, and also have greater energy efficiency. They can be found in all kinds of properties from old-fashioned homes to contemporary new builds. They can be put in any room, but they are particularly suitable for bathrooms and kitchens, which offer a clear view of the outside. In addition to their versatility, there are other advantages to choosing the casement window. One of these is the fact that they're easy to clean and maintain. There are no sashes that can be moved, so dirt and dust cannot gather. You can also open and shut them with ease, allowing you to let in lots of fresh air and sunlight whenever you like. Casement windows aren't just energy efficient, but they also add character and charm to a home. They can be customized to your liking with different glazing bars and finishes. Timber bay windows A bay window adds elegance to any home. They can create a feeling of space in your house and provide panoramic views to your garden or outdoor area. They are available in a wide selection of colors and materials to suit your needs, from traditional wood to aluminum. However they can be expensive, so it is important to know the costs before making a decision. A uPVC bay window is the most sought-after choice for homeowners. It is sturdy, low maintenance and is insulation. A three-section uPVC Bay Window is priced between PS1,250 and PS1,950, including the supply and labor. A four-section bay window can cost around PS2,700. the five-section version can cost up to PS3,700. A bay window made of timber is a different kind of bay. This is a great option for those who wish to preserve their traditional home and use a green material. Timber bay windows add warmth and character, and can be customized to suit your requirements. It can be made of softwood, hardwood or Accoya which is a high-quality hardwood. Accoya, a hardwood engineered to be durable and efficient, can be treated in order to give it a stunning appearance. Accoya is available in various sizes and is able to be painted or stained. It is also a good choice for windows that need to be bent. A bay window isn't just beautiful, but it can also increase the efficiency of your home's energy use. They can be used to increase storage space or reduce heat loss. They are also a great method to make your home more comfortable especially during the summertime.
